Senior Event Coordinator
Opus Agency
Role Description A Senior Event Coordinator, you will be responsible for leading small scale in-person and digital events and experiential campaigns under limited supervision. You will own components of small to medium-scale events as well as provide assistance on events as assigned. Event components may include: - Facility and vendor management - Food and beverage coordination - Temporary staff management - Exhibit hall management - Sponsorship or signage management Programs assigned may include: - Conferences - Trade shows - Dinners - Corporate galas - Incentive programs You will work with, and learn from, the industry’s best in a dynamic, growing agency. Qualifications - 2+ years of project/event management experience, preferably in the event industry. - Demonstrated experience leading and owning components on events. Please specify events worked on and role in resume. - Bachelor's Degree (B.A.) from four-year institution preferred. Requirements - Assume responsibility for success of assigned components of an event or project, meeting client objectives and client and manager expectations. - Utilize creative problem solving all along the planning cycle, consistently looking for ways to deliver more effectively. - Master effective and timely communication between internal team, clients, and vendors via phone and email. - Effectively interface with financial manager and manage component specific budgets with proactive communication. - Report to program lead(s) as assigned, on a regular basis with project progress, identified problems and solutions. - Establish good relations with vendors and work with vendors in securing needed materials on time, within budget and meeting requested specifications. - Maintain excellent communication with manager regarding special problems or exceptions to policies and procedures. - Able to effectively delegate to staff above and below this position. - Keep teams updated on new program processes, current program issues, ongoing challenges and solutions. - Manage vital program documents such as: event contact sheet, production schedule, event timeline, onsite crew cards, meeting agendas and notes, PowerPoint decks, show plan, and wrap-up document. - Actively participate in team meetings as required by providing challenges and solutions to benefit other team members and treating all proprietary information as confidential. - Training and mentorship of junior team members.
